5 Peaks - Mt. Seymour
The 5 Peaks event at Mt. Seymour takes place on trails within Mount Seymour Provincial Park, located about 30 minutes from downtown Vancouver. The Sport and Enduro courses wind through dense BC forest and pass around Goldie and Flower lakes.
Available distances include:
- 1 km Kid's
- 3 km Kid's
- 6.5 km Sport Run or Hike
- 10 km Enduro Run or Hike
- 14.1 km Grit Run
A non-competitive hiking division is offered with two pace leaders, allowing participants to walk the full course without timing or a podium. Estimated finish times are about 2 hours for the Sport course and 3 hours for the Enduro. Participants in the hiking division must not run during the course.
Safety and logistics notes: dogs, headphones, and strollers are not allowed on the course. Nordic walking poles are permitted only in the non-competitive hiking division. Washroom facilities are located in the parking lot. Spectators are welcome, with best viewing from the start and finish area. Parking is described as plentiful.
Optional swag and finisher medals can be purchased prior to the event or on site while supplies last. Awards are presented to top finishers in each timed category and must be picked up at the event.
